Dispensation theology is just a study of the relationship between God and man on this earth from creation until this earth is destroyed.

it tries to separate different ages into groups in order to help people look at a passage and help them to get historical context.

and example is the age of innocence. This is a time period between the creation of Adam until the fall.

another example is the church age. that is the current age that began at pentacost and will continue until the tribulation period begins.

Another is the age of Israel. Which includes the time from when Moses was given the law, Until the church age began.
